Detailed Description
The technical solution of the present invention will be further explained with reference to the accompanying drawings and specific embodiments.
Example one
As shown in fig. 1-3, the utility model provides a splashproof dummy car for material pot, including trolley frame 1 and the mount 2 of fixing in trolley frame 1, the upside of mount 2 is fixed with gear motor 3, the downside of trolley frame 1 is fixed with two pairs of otic placodes, the downside of trolley frame 1 is provided with a pair of major axis 4, two pairs of otic placodes activity cover are respectively established on two major axes 4, the both ends of each major axis 4 are all fixed with rail wheel 5, through sprocket drive assembly 6 transmission connection between the major axis 4 on gear motor 3's output shaft and the right side, sprocket drive assembly 6 includes the driven chain dish of fixing the driving chain dish on the major axis 4 on gear motor 3 output shaft and fixing cover on major axis 4, connect through chain transmission between driving chain dish and the driven chain dish; a pair of anti-collision blocks 7 is fixed on the right side of the trolley frame 1, a travel switch 8 matched with the anti-collision blocks 7 for use is fixed on the lower side of the trolley frame 1, a fixed seat 9 fixed on the ground is arranged on the front side of the trolley frame 1, a hydraulic cylinder 10 is fixed on the fixed seat 9, and a matching block 11 matched with the hydraulic cylinder 10 is fixed on the lower side of the trolley frame 1.
In this embodiment, when using, when the trolley frame 1 needs to remove, with gear motor 3 switch on, gear motor 3's output shaft passes through sprocket drive assembly 6 and drives major axis 4 and rotate, and then makes rail wheel 5 rotate, realizes the removal of trolley frame 1. When the trolley frame 1 moves to the unloading position, the travel switch 8 fixed on the right side of the trolley frame 1 is contacted with the external matching abutting part, the travel switch 8 is prevented from being damaged by collision through the limitation of the anti-collision block 7, the speed reducing motor 3 is disconnected with the power supply after the travel switch 8 is contacted, and the trolley frame 1 stops moving. The hydraulic cylinder 10 is controlled to be started, the telescopic rod of the hydraulic cylinder 10 is matched and inserted with the matching block 11 fixed on the trolley frame 1, and then the position of the trolley frame 1 is limited, so that stable discharging can be carried out.
Example two
As shown in fig. 1-4, the utility model provides a material is splashproof dummy car for alms bowl, based on embodiment one, this embodiment still includes: a platform plate 12 is fixed on the upper side of the trolley frame 1, four limiting columns 13 penetrate through the upper side of the platform plate 12 at equal intervals in the circumferential direction, four sliding grooves for the limiting columns 13 to slide are formed in the upper side of the platform plate 12 at equal intervals in the circumferential direction, and the four limiting columns 13 are located in the four sliding grooves; one side of every restriction post 13 that keeps away from the center of landing slab 12 all is fixed with a pair of short slab 14 that is located both sides about landing slab 12, and the lower extreme of every restriction post 13 all is fixed with spliced pole 15, and equal fixedly connected with wire rope 16 on every spliced pole 15, the downside center department of landing slab 12 is rotated and is connected with the shrink subassembly that is used for a plurality of wire rope 16 synchronous movement. The contraction assembly comprises a central shaft 17 which is rotatably connected to the center of the lower side of the platform plate 12, a disc 18 is fixedly sleeved on the central shaft 17, four short columns 19 are fixed on the lower side of the disc 18 at equal intervals in the circumferential direction, the other ends of four steel wire ropes 16 are respectively fixedly connected with the four short columns 19, a driving disc 20 is fixed at the lower end of the central shaft 17, and the driving disc 20 comprises a rotating wheel and a plurality of fixed clamping blocks which are fixed on the circumferential surface of the driving disc 20 at equal intervals; a fixed plate 21 is fixed on the front side of the trolley frame 1, and a screw 22 for abutting against the driving plate 20 is connected to the fixed plate 21 in a threaded manner; the diameter of the screw 22 is smaller than the distance between two adjacent fixed blocks on the drive disc 20; four blocks 23 corresponding to the positions of the sliding grooves are fixed on the lower side of the platform plate 12 at equal intervals in the circumferential direction by taking the central shaft 17 as the axis, and a spring 24 is fixed between one side of each block 23 far away from the central shaft 17 and the corresponding limiting column 13.
In this embodiment, when the trolley frame 1 is used, before the trolley frame needs to be unloaded, the position of the limiting column 13 can be adjusted in advance according to the diameter of the used material bowl. The screw 22 on the fixing plate 21 is rotated and loosened, and the restriction of the screw 22 on the drive disc 20 is released. Then the driving disc 20 is rotated, the driving disc 20 drives the short column 19 on the disc 18 to rotate through the central shaft 17, and the short column 19 makes circular motion. The short column 19 pulls the steel wire rope 16 fixedly connected with the short column, and then drives the connecting column 15 fixed by the steel wire rope 16 to move, so that the limiting column 13 on the connecting column 15 is limited to move. The restricting posts 13 are stably moved by the short plates 14 and the sliding grooves, and the plurality of restricting posts 13 are moved synchronously until the restricting posts 13 are moved to a proper position. During the movement, the spring 24 between the restraining post 13 and the block 23 is compressed. The adjustment is then completed by rotating the screw 22 so that the screw 22 abuts the drive plate 20, restricting rotation of the drive plate 20. The discharging material bowl is limited among the four limiting columns 13, so that the splashing caused by deviation in the moving process is avoided.
